The Real Life of an Expert: Introducing the New CCIE Security


CCIE Security 4.0 is unusual among security certificates for its

up-to-date, real-world content. It emphasizes security competency and

efficient problem solving in networks that use cloud services, carry

voice and ** traffic, and are accessed by a variety of wireless devices.


The content, currently in development, may include real-world applications that involve:


Securing both wireless and wired networks, including managing security policy by device and service


Extending application awareness to security devices, moving security up

to Layer 7 from the stateless packets of Layers 3 and 4, and applying

policy on a per-identity basis


Applying security policy in a network that has voice and video traffic


Securing networks that use managed services, dual ISPs, IPv6, or IP multicast


Cisco will soon announce the blueprints for the
CCIE Security 4.0 written and lab exams; the first exam will take place
approximately six months later.
